If you don't have the programs that came with your camera, look (in the internet) for "Downloader" and "BreezeBrowser". You can download your foto's from the camera (USB) to your PC with downloader alone. If you also have to manage your foto's it's good to download BreezeBrowser too. The programs work very good togheter but should be installed separately. You can try them (somewhat constrained) and buy them (fully working).
